The Highland is a traditional flat roof tile with a mock joint, which gives the appearance of small slates or tiles when they are laid broken bonded.

Certification

All Russell Roof Tiles are manufactured in accordance with the requirements of BS EN 490 “Concrete Roof Tiles and Fittings-Product specifications” and BS EN 491 “Concrete Roof Tiles and Fitting-Test Methods”.

Each one of Russell’s tiles are made from the hard-wearing material concrete. The tiles provide excellent thermal insulation from heat, between the roof tile and ceiling, especially during summer months and protect the underlying membrane from deterioration. In cold climates, concrete roof tiles work against snow, ice accumulation and help retain heat as opposed to clay roof tiles, which can crack and damage easily in cold weather.
